如果MySQL检测到崩溃或损坏的表,则需要先修复它才能再次使用。 本指南将引导您检测崩溃的表以及如何修复MyISAM表。...MyISAM表 通常一个表在mysql日志中显示为损坏,为了找到日志的位置,你可以在my.cnf中找到它,或者你可以通过以下方式直接在mysql中查看它: MariaDB [(none)]> show...MyISAM表 一旦找到需要修复的表,您可以直接通过MySQL进行修复。...mysql.time_zone_transition_type OK mysql.user OK test.Persons OK test.tablename OK test.testtable OK 此命令将尝试检查并修复服务器上每个数据库中的所有...那就是修复MySQL中的MyISAM表。
VideoView盖住,当视频加载好后再把图片去掉(为什么不是VideoView盖住图片,如果这样的话再把VideoView展示出来的时候会有一个黑屏,比较影响体验) () private var playingVideoViews = HashSetVideoView>() // 在RecyclerView滚动监听中调用这个方法,注意要判断一下...为空,或者url为空的时候下面就不走了,这时候视频是没法加载的,展示出来的就是一个黑屏,因为这个holder复用的前面的,前面的已经把图片去掉了,所以后面需要把图片加回来,也就是常说的RecyclerView...中写了if,就得写else。...()方法,这里应该是不同实现有不同的写法,我这里的写法是会判断一下这个视频的状态,如果是播放中就不会再执行start(),那为什么会在播放中呢,因为复用了前面的视频,他处在了播放中的状态,所以这里就会出现这个情况
VideoView 的使用非常简单,播放视频的步骤: 在界面布局文件中定义 VideoView 组件,或在程序中创建 VideoView 组件 调用 VideoView 的如下两个方法来加载指定的视频:...VideoView加载网络视频时,常见黑屏情况,因为VideoView每次都会重新加载。...因为 ExoPlayer 是一个包含在你的应用中的库,对于你使用哪个版本有完全的控制权,并且你可以简单的跟随应用的升级而升级; 更少的适配性问题。...2.在 Activity 的 onCreate 方法中添加如下代码,初始化 Vitamio 的解码器 @Override public void onCreate(Bundle icicle) {...LibsChecker.checkVitamioLibs(this)) return; } 3.在 AndroidManifest.xml 中声明 InitActivity <activity
题目部分 如何在Oracle中写操作系统文件,如写日志? 答案部分 可以利用UTL_FILE包,但是,在此之前,要注意设置好UTL_FILE_DIR初始化参数。...image.png 其它常见问题如下表所示: 问题 答案 Oracle中哪个包可以获取环境变量的值? 可以通过DBMS_SYSTEM.GET_ENV来获取环境变量的当前生效值。...在CLIENT_INFO列中存放程序的客户端信息;MODULE列存放主程序名,如包的名称;ACTION列存放程序包中的过程名。该包不仅提供了设置这些列值的过程,还提供了返回这些列值的过程。...如何在存储过程中暂停指定时间? DBMS_LOCK包的SLEEP过程。例如:“DBMS_LOCK.SLEEP(5);”表示暂停5秒。 DBMS_OUTPUT提示缓冲区不够,怎么增加?...如何在Oracle中写操作系统文件,如写日志? 可以利用UTL_FILE包,但是,在此之前,要注意设置好UTL_FILE_DIR初始化参数。
https://blog.csdn.net/wkyseo/article/details/77880535 最近项目中需要使用video来代替有点复杂的动画(video循环自动播放),遇到了使用过程中的两个坑...preference name="AllowInlineMediaPlayback" value="true" /> 对了,行内播放之后还解决了一个问题,可以在video视窗使用定位来增加遮罩等功能 video自动播放黑屏...最开始产品需求是视频加载自动播放并且循环,导致快速切换页面再加载视频经常黑屏很长一段时间才能播放 寻求解决思路: 一.... 问题:依然存在黑屏,换成onplay尝试无解 网上说是videoview在加载第二个视频时 默认会释放到第一个视频的资源再加载第二个视频的资源 这个比较耗内存 会出现短暂的黑屏
浏览图片时,默认情况下上一张图片的状态是不会恢复的,了解的朋友肯定知道是Viewpager的缓存问题,要解决的话重写Viewpager修改缓存数,这样当然可以,但是效果的话,并不是很好,滑动的时候下一页处于黑屏状态...//获取当前页面的view View child=mViewPager.getChildAt(i); //获取当前页面中的...layout_height="140dp" android:background="#333333" android:layout_marginLeft="20dp" /> 视频的话我用的是VideoView
一 VideoView基本介绍 videoView是Android平台上用于播放视频的控件,它提供了一些常见属性和方法来控制视频的播放。...二 VideoView使用方法 在布局文件中添加VideoView: VideoView android:id="@+id/videoview" android:layout_width...videoView.start(); } } 注意:在使用VideoView时要确保已获取相关权限(如网络访问权限),并在AndroidManifest.xml文件中进行相应的声明。...四 VideoView简单Demo 准备视频文件: 在项目的res目录下创建raw文件夹,并将要播放的视频文件(例如video.mp4)放入该文件夹中。...在布局文件中添加VideoView: VideoView android:id="@+id/videoView" android:layout_width="match_parent"
ExoPlayerView是在实际工作中的产物,可能并无法完全满足各位的实际工作中的要求,但可以借鉴下。...4.支持简单的手势操作,如快进快退,调节音量。...用法 导入 在 build.gradle 中加入 compile 'com.jarvanmo:exoplayerview:1.0.0' ExoPlayerView 可以直接播放如mp4,m3u8 等简单视频...在布局文件中引入 ExoVideoView: <com.jarvanmo.exoplayerview.ui.ExoVideoView android:id="@+id/videoView...中.
腾讯云视立方控制台 > License 管理 > 移动端 License 获取对应 LicenseURL 和 LicenseKey,但是如果没有申请移动端播放器高级版 License,将会出现视频播放失败、黑屏等现象...] init];videoView.frame = self.view.bounds;videoView.delegate = self;[self.view addSubview:self.videoView...1080[self.videoView switchResolution:1080*1920 index:-1];/// 2、切换当前正在播放的视频的分辨率到1080[self.videoView switchResolution...TUIShortVideoView alloc] initWithUIManager:uiManager];上面的代码,通过 TUIPlayerShortVideoUIManager 自定义了视频控制层(如进度条...升级 SDK 版本步骤请去SDK 集成指引中查阅使用,这里不再过多说明。
另一种问题就是游戏兼容性问题,比如win10,win11系统无法运行红色警戒2死机卡死问题,显卡驱动问题,显卡驱动版本过高或兼容问题出现的黑屏等也是需要解决的。...黑屏了但可以听到声音如果游戏黑屏了但是可以听到声音,那么就是分辨率有问题1、进入到游戏的安装目录中,然后用记事本的方式打开【rar2.ini】文件;2、找到【[Video]】参数下的【Screen】分辨率代码...没有存档重新开始问题3:在win10 win11系统中玩红警2、尤里的复仇,会黑屏但有声音解决步骤红警2修复文件地址从上面下载补丁解压后把“ ddraw.dll ”复制到红警2的安装目录ra2.exe所在目录...本程序适用于多个操作系统,如Windows XP、Windows Vista、Windows 7、Windows 8、Windows 8.1、Windows 8.1 Update、Windows 10、...每个版本均已实测,有问题的都已修复,win10-11系统运行不报毒,不卡顿,不闪退,不黑屏!每个版本都可以单独下载,还配备了10000张地图,200+任务包以及修改器!
在React Native开发过程中,有时我们想要使用原生的一个UI组件或者是js比较难以实现的功能时,我们可以在react Naitve应用程序中封装和植入已有的原生组件。..."topChange",//事件名称 event//事件携带的数据 ); } receiveEvent接收三个参数,参数说明如注释所示...',VideoView,{ nativeOnly: {onChange: true} }); module.exports = VideoView; 我们在java中发送的事件中携带的数据WritableMap...中,定义的key与在js中event.nativeEvent.duration一致,nativeEvent和key就可以获取到value。...自定义事件名称 首先,在VideoViewManager类中重写getExportedCustomDirectEventTypeConstants方法,然后自定义事件名称。
,如开始/暂停按钮、上一个/下一个按钮、快进/快退按钮,以及进度条等控件;把VideoView与MediaController关联起来,便是一个类似于Window Media Player的精简版播放器...因此我们不会在布局文件中声明MediaController控件,只会声明VideoView控件,然后让控制条附着与视频视图之上。...甚至布局文件中都不用声明视频视图,而在代码中动态添加视频画面,由此便衍生出VideoView和MediaController的两种集成方式: 1、在布局文件中声明VideoView。...2、在代码中动态添加VideoView。 VideoView对象的使用步骤同上。...下面是在布局文件中声明VideoView的代码例子: import java.util.Map; import com.aqi00.lib.dialog.FileSelectFragment; import
videoView = (VideoView) findViewById(R.id.video_view); videoView.setVideoPath(Environment.getExternalStorageDirectory...在onCreate()方法中获取到了VideoView的实例,给它设置了一个视频文件的地址,然后调用start()方法开始播放。...注意一定要将DanmakuView写在VideoView的下面,因为RelativeLayout中后添加的控件会被覆盖在上面。...videoView = (VideoView) findViewById(R.id.video_view); videoView.setVideoPath(Environment.getExternalStorageDirectory...接着调用DanmakuContext.create()方法创建了一个DanmakuContext的实例,DanmakuContext可以用于对弹幕的各种全局配置进行设定,如设置字体、设置最大显示行数等。
本来只是想让电脑快点、干净点,结果第二天一开机:黑屏了、蓝屏了、无限重启了,甚至连桌面都见不到了!很多用户在删文件时,根本分不清哪些是“能删的”,哪些是“绝对不能动的”。...下面这些文件或目录,一旦被删除,就极有可能导致电脑无法启动:Windows 系统目录(如 C:\Windows 下的文件)。这是整个操作系统的“心脏”。...你哪怕删掉一个不起眼的 .dll 文件,都可能导致系统启动失败、蓝屏或黑屏。启动项相关驱动或程序文件。...如果你用注册表编辑器“乱搞一通”,后果可能就是无法开机、黑屏,甚至设备识别错误。电脑不能正常启动的几种表现形式在排查问题之前,先明确你的电脑目前处于哪种无法开机状态:1. 直接黑屏,无任何提示。...方法二:使用系统恢复工具(安装U盘)修复启动问题适用场景:系统进不了安全模式;启动过程中蓝屏或报错(如“bootmgr缺失”、“INACCESSIBLE_BOOT_DEVICE”等);误删了引导信息或核心驱动文件
网络权限 二.实现思路以及核心代码 1.最开始的思路 利用Jsoup框架爬取网页中的视频地址...frist; String videoUrl = element.attr("src"); 到这发现有一层防爬措施,获取不到视频链接 2.另一种思路 为解决此问题,反编译拥有此功能的APP后,从smali文件中得到另一种思路...void showSource(final String html) { //html为保存的网页代码 } } 2.使用Jsoup解析本地网页(此操作写在子线程中)...播放(低版本的测试机器,未适配高版本机器)(主线程中进行) videoview.setVideoPath(aftervideoUrl); videoview.requestFocus(); videoview.start...(); 效果图 由此可见,可以获取到链接,拿到链接后就可以进行其他操作了,如视频下载等。
3、首次运行谷歌地球,需要点击“文件一 登录服务器”,如果软件界面显示黑屏。 4、选择“帮助一启动修复工具”。 5、先关闭谷歌地球软件,保留“修复Google地球界面”不要关闭。...如果谷歌地球软件无法运行,请在windows系统任务管理器中,结束“googleearth.exe”进程,然后在运行谷歌地球软件。...8、如果执行第7步谷歌地球软件还是黑屏,请重复执行第4、5、6步,选择“清除磁盘缓存、删除我的位置、打开安全模式”,在次执行第7步。 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
电脑开机直接黑屏是怎么回事: 1.先看看显示器电源是否接通,若接通,则看看你的显示器开关是否打开; 2.再看看主机电源指示灯是否亮,不亮则考虑你的电源可能坏了,如亮则听听主机通电后的声音,如果很清脆的一声...电脑黑屏故障解决方法: (1)如果换另外显示器电脑正常启动,那么原显示器可能损坏; (2)系统是否安装软件和更新补丁,如有请卸载更新文件; (3)电脑安装软件后重启正在更新导致黑屏,等待更新完毕即可;...(4)检查显示器电缆是否牢固可靠地插入到主机接口,再检查显卡与主板I/O插槽之间的接触是否良好; (5)可进安全模式修复电脑,如果不能进安全模式,请重新安装系统; (6)检查电脑CPU风扇是否运转; (...若电脑依然黑屏,则建议更换主板 电脑开机黑屏解决方法: 1.启动计算机时,在系统进入 Windows 启动画面前,按下 F8 键;出现操作系统多模式启动菜单后,用键盘上的方向键选择“SafeMode”...启动完成后,单击开始,在搜索框中输入regedit.exe;按下回车键;打开注册表编辑器。
猫头虎 分享:如何在服务器中Ping特定的端口号? 网络调试的实用技巧,学会这些工具,你将成为运维与开发中的“Ping”王!...在日常开发和运维中,我们经常需要检查目标主机上的某个端口是否开启,并确定网络连通性。
一、软件简介AnyMP4 Video Repair 是一款专业视频修复工具,可修复因损坏、中断下载、存储错误、病毒攻击等导致的无法播放的视频文件(如MP4/MOV/AVI等格式)。...支持修复画面卡顿、音画不同步、马赛克、黑屏等常见问题。二、安装与启动下载安装下载:axuezy网双击安装包,按向导完成安装。启动软件桌面双击图标,或从开始菜单打开。...三、基础修复步骤步骤1:添加损坏视频点击界面中的 "Add"(添加) 按钮,选择需修复的视频文件(可批量添加)。支持格式:MP4、MOV、AVI、M4V、3GP等。...步骤2:选择修复模式快速修复(Quick Repair):适用于轻微损坏(如播放卡顿)。高级修复(Advanced Repair):需提供同设备的正常参考视频(相同格式/分辨率),修复严重损坏文件。...修复成功率:轻度损坏:90%以上可恢复。严重损坏(如文件头部损坏):需依赖参考视频。输出格式:修复后的视频保持原始格式,无法直接转换格式(需配合转换器使用)。
可是音乐播放这种功能在Android系统中是如何实现的呢?本小节中我们就学习如何使用android.media.MediaPlayer类播放保存在apk中或SD卡中的音频文件。...所谓的视频播放指的是在Android设备上播放如3gp格式、rmvb格式、mp4格式的等各种视频文件。...使用VideoView播放视频的步骤如下: (1) 在布局文件中定义一个VideoView组件,当然也可以在Java代码中直接使用new生成。...="fill_parent" /> 在布局文件中定义了一个VideoView组件,接下来就可以在程序中使用这个组件播放视频了。...图4.1.4 SD卡中文件图 图4.1.5 VideoView播放器效果图 4.3 使用MediaRecord录制音频 随着生活节奏的提高,更多的人选择用手机中的录音功能来记录身边发生的点点滴滴,而录音功能相比于传统的纸笔记事来说更加便捷